Saint-Augustin is a parish municipality in the Maria-Chapdelaine Regional County Municipality in the Saguenay–Lac-Saint-Jean region of Quebec, Canada. The municipality had a population of 351 as of the Canada 2016 Census.[4]

Demographics

In the 2021 Census of Population conducted by Statistics Canada, Saint-Augustin had a population of 334 living in 148 of its 161 total private dwellings, a change of -4.8% from its 2016 population of 351. With a land area of 104.25 km2 (40.25 sq mi), it had a population density of 3.2/km2 (8.3/sq mi) in 2021.[5]

Population trend:[6]

  • Population in 2016: 351 (2011 to 2016 population change: -12.3%)
  • Population in 2011: 400 (2006 to 2011 population change: 1.8%)
  • Population in 2006: 393
  • Population in 2001: 424
  • Population in 1996: 486
  • Population in 1991: 534

Mother tongue:[4]

  • English as first language: 0%
  • French as first language: 100%
  • English and French as first language: 0%
  • Other as first language: 0%
